Ann Silcox Moreland, a beacon of love passed away peacefully on November 6, 2025, at her home in Greenville, SC, Born on January 28, 1946, in Chestertown, MD, Ann's life was a tapestry of generosity and warmth that touched everyone she met.

Ann's journey began as the eldest of six children. Her early years in Maryland were filled with the joys of family life, which laid the foundation for the incredible person she would become.

Survived by her husband James E. Moreland, her three children, James H. Moreland, his wife Renee, Kelly A. Schifferdecker, her husband Jon, and Jeffrey C. Moreland, his wife Beth, eight grandchildren and one great-grandchild and 5 younger brothers. Ann's role as a mother was one she held most dear, often referred to by her children as the "Best Mom Ever," a title she earned every day through her unwavering support and boundless love.

Ann's talents were many, and her hands were rarely still. She was an artist with a needle and thread, creating beautiful pieces through her sewing that will be cherished for generations. Her woodworking skills were equally impressive, with each piece reflecting her attention to detail and her creative spirit. Ann also found solace and joy in working in her yard, where she cultivated beauty and a sense of tranquility that she shared with all who visited.
